This is the COVID-19 Daily Update from the Allegheny County Health Department (ACHD) for April 5, 2020:
Confirmed cases – 605
Hospitalization (past or present) – 87
Deaths – 4
A fourth death in the county from COVID-19 has been reported. The individual was in their 80s and had been hospitalized. Our deepest condolences to their family and friends on their loss.
The ages and genders of those in the county who are sick with COVID-19 are listed below.
Ages—Number confirmed (percentage—all percents rounded)
00-04 – 3 (less than 1%)
05-12 – 4 (less than 1%)
13-18 – 9 (1%)
19-24 – 56 (9%)
25-49 – 263 (43%)
50-64 – 164 (27%)
65+ -- 106 (18%)
Gender
Female – 306 (51%)
Male – 299 (49%)
